Application Security in a DevOps, Cloud and API World

Security teams are challenged to modernize application security practices in light of accelerating shifts to DevOps delivery models and rapid adoption of cloud-native application designs. Applications built on microservices (e.g. serverless, containers, APIs) and delivered continuously are outpacing application security teams ability to secure them. CISOs need to consider new skills, new touch points and new platforms to maintain a strong security posture in light of these trends and the speed at which they are re-shaping IT.

Cloud Security

The speed, flexibility, and scale of cloud computing has fundamentally transformed business operations and competitive dynamics.  As organizations accelerate innovation, an overwhelming majority of IT executives regularly cite security as the #1 challenge when operating in the cloud.  With adversaries increasingly targeting cloud services with both opportunistic and targeted attacks, how can security leaders devise a multi-cloud security strategy that not only works with the business to enable agility but also protects vital corporate secrets and customer data?  Join the discussion as our panel examines cloud security challenges and potential countermeasures.

The Explosion of API Security

How do CISOs get the most out of APIs while limiting the risk? 20 years ago the motives for hackers were website defacement and getting your name on all those defacements. That was the point of hacking. Now, it’s all about monetizing the data you can steal. Just as cloud computing initially seeped into organizations under the cloak of shadow IT, application programming interface (API) adoption has often followed an organic, inexact, and unaudited path. IT leaders know they are benefiting from APIs, internal, via third parties, and often outwardly exposed. They just don’t know where they are, how much they support key services, and how they’re being used, or abused! In this session, we will discuss if APIs are meant to be exposed, and discuss if the startup's API software companies are ready for the explosion.

Cloud Data Security

According to Gartner, 79% of companies have experienced at least one cloud data breach during the pandemic. But the migration of critical business data to the cloud shows no sign of slowing. In fact, it’s accelerating. Yet, despite powerful trends and mounting threats, traditional data security has simply not kept pace with the cloud. Security teams still struggle to even understand the reality of what sensitive data they have in the cloud and its associated risks. This is not a sustainable status quo. Data is increasingly a business most valuable asset. And until organizations can align around a shared Data Reality, cloud security will remain several steps behind intensifying security threats and tightening data regulations.
